Motivation
More discussions : https://github.com/apache/kafka/pull/16260#issuecomment-2159632052
Logging library used in tools module is inconsistent with core. slf4j2.x provides a cleaner and simpler approach.
By adding slf4j backends to dependencies, distributions will have their own slf4j backends, and its safe to define a slf4j provider in run-class. This allows to run kafka instance from source code with a specific provider too.

Proposed Changes
- Upgrade slf4j from 1.7.36 to 2.0.9+
- Add a new system variable to run-class (sh & bat) script to define -Dslf4j.provider. By default we use org.slf4j.reload4j.Reload4jServiceProvider
- Add other slf4j backend binding dependencies
Compatibility, Deprecation, and Migration Plan
Make sure users code works well when they provide their own slf4j jars
Ex : If slf4j-api is upgraded to 2.0.9, we also provide the compatible binding jars of a few backends like logback, log4j, reload4j, commons logging in kafka itself. As we introduce this change in major version 4.0.0, this should be ok for users to upgrade their backend dependencies and we can also provide the compatible backend dependencies.
This way, users get an upgraded logging library.
